DTC B2772: Control Module Communication Stuck
DTC detecting condition:
When all the following conditions are met.
- Battery voltage stays at 10 V or more for longer than one second.
- CAN bus is not in sleep state.
- Clear memory is not in process.
- CAN message register freezes in the TPMS & keyless entry control module or the keyless entry control module
Trouble symptom:
- Communication is impossible with Subaru Select Monitor.
- Lock/unlock cannot be operated with keyless entry.

- CHECK DTC
.
- Turn the ignition switch to OFF.
- Disconnect the TPMS & keyless entry control module connector or keyless entry control module connector.
- Connect the disconnected connectors.
- Using the Subaru Select Monitor, perform the clear memory of [Keyless Entry]. Ref. to COMMON (diag)>CLEAR MEMORY .
- Turn the ignition switch to OFF.
- Turn the ignition switch to ON.
- Read the DTC of [Keyless Entry] using the Subaru Select Monitor. Ref. to KEYLESS ENTRY (DIAGNOSTICS)>D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ODE (DTC) .
Is DTC B2772 displayed? (Current malfunction)
Yes : Replace the TPMS & keyless entry control module or keyless entry control module. Ref. to SECURITY AND LOCKS>KEYLESS ENTRY CONTROL MODULE .
No : Even if DTC is displayed, the circuit has returned to a normal condition at this time. Reproduce the failure, and then perform the diagnosis again.
NOTE: In this case, temporary poor contact of connector, temporary open or short circuit of harness may be the cause.
